Original web page at AnchorCert backs new Diamond ISO Standard The Birmingham Assay Office’s AnchorCert Gem Lab has welcomed the recent publication of a new diamond ISO Standard. The standard, entitled ‘Consumer Confidence in the Diamond Industry’, was published on 1 st July, and AnchorCert described it as a “refreshingly simple and concise document intended…
